Subject: Cursor pagination cut-over is done

Hi all — quick wrap-up on the Orbitview API change. As of last night, offset pagination is gone and all list endpoints use cursors. Most plugins migrated cleanly; a few hit the new page-size cap, so double-check anything that requested huge pages. Old-style params now return a clear error rather than silently truncating, which should make debugging easier. So you can update your defaults, the live pagination settings are below.

service settings:
[casax]
port = 6379
team = rusir
host = casax.zemvarhq.corp
region = outer-4
access_code = ac_9808ce
timeout_ms = 1500

## Getting Started with the ChipGate Reader

Welcome, plugin folks! The ChipGate reader streams timing-chip pings over a simple event bus, and your plugin just subscribes to the splits it cares about. Nothing exotic — register a handler, declare your checkpoints, and you're off. Sample plugins and the full event schema live on our internal docs page:

wiki page, fahif-bawep: https://jira.tolvaqsys.internal/browse/projects/projects/67caf315

For the security review: we're retiring the homegrown Marrow job queue and moving Ordway's batch workloads onto Latchline. Marrow had no message-level auth and stored payloads unencrypted on the broker host; Latchline fixes both. All producers are migrated; two consumers in the reporting tier still dual-read until next sprint. TLS is enforced broker-side, mutual auth on worker connections. Review focus: token scoping and payload encryption settings. The Latchline production instance currently runs with these values.

deployment values, faduf-tawep:
SORDOR_LOG_LEVEL=error
SORDOR_METRICS_HOST=metrics.sordor.nelvrolabs.internal
SORDOR_POOL_SIZE=4

Onboarding note for the Ledgerpane admin table: bulk edits are applied through the batcher service, not directly against the database. Select rows, choose an action, and the batcher stages changes in a pending set you can review before commit. Edits over 500 rows require a second approver — this is enforced server-side, so don't try to chunk around it. To run the batcher locally you need the staging write credential, which goes in your .env as the next line.

secret setting of bahip-kagag: RELAY_SECRET3=c83